Transfer requests are accepted all year long.
If your child already has an approved Intra-District Transfer and is in good standing (attendance, academics, behavior), you do not need to reapply. Your child stays through the TK–5 or 6–8 grade span unless the school becomes impacted.
Students not in good standing may be notified by the school regarding possible revocation.
Inter-District Transfers (OUT of MUSD): Processed during the Priority Window and must be renewed annually.
Inter-District Transfers (INTO MUSD): Processed as received during the Priority Window.
MUSD is growing quickly, and some schools have limited space. Submitting during the Priority Window increases the chance of approval.
The Student Success Services Department reviews all transfer requests. Families will receive written notification via email.
Transfer approval depends on spacing and staffing, and may be revoked at any time if:
The student has excessive absences or tardies
The student is dropped off too early or picked up too late
Behavior expectations are not met
Academic effort is not demonstrated (Education Code 35160.5)
There is no longer room at the school or grade level
False or misleading information was provided
To appeal a denial, submit a written explanation within 30 days.
Your appeal will be reviewed by the Assistant Superintendent of Education Services, and you will receive a written response within 10 calendar days.
